
Tom Petty, the frontman of The Heartbreakers, died Monday at the age of 66 after he was found unconscious at his home in California. Following the news of death, many artists took to various social media platforms to offer their prayers and condolences.
Petty was rushed to the hospital after he suffered a massive cardiac arrest Sunday. He was taken off the life support after he was found to be brain dead Monday. Although the Los Angeles Police Department issued a statement confirming his death on Monday afternoon, they ended up retracting the same.
The news of his death was confirmed only when his family tweeted out a statement on his official social media page. “On behalf of the Tom Petty family, we are devastated to announce the untimely death of our father, husband, brother, leader, and friend Tom Petty,” the statement read.
Even before the police confirmed Petty’s death, messages of love and condolences started to pour in from music artists and other celebrities for the rock n’ roll icon.
